Latest Patents

Stephen F. Spencer holds one patent for his invention titled "Localization Needle Assembly." This assembly features an outer tubular cannula and a reinforced needle structure that can slide between extended and retracted positions. The design includes a retractable barb and a non-retractable barb, which are contained within the outer cannula during the initial targeting of a lesion. Once the target area is reached, the inner needle structure is retracted, allowing the retractable barb to anchor the assembly in body tissue. This innovative approach facilitates precise targeting for biopsy procedures.
